2010-09-30 6 views
0

Je ne peux pas enregistrer avec succès les données reçues avec le serveur nusoap avec le bon codage. Les caractères de langue (tchèque) sont toujours remplacés par un point d'interrogation. J'utilise PHP 5.3 et nusoap 0.9.5. J'ai essayé de remplacer chaque ISO-8859-1 avec UTF-8 dans le code source nusoap mais je ne peux pas faire ce travail. Tous les conseils seraient très appréciés.Perdre le caractère de langue avec nusoap

Répondre

0

NuSOAP utilise toujours ISO-8859-1 pour le WSDL. Cela signifie que les identifiants dans le WSDL, par ex. noms de méthodes et de paramètres, doit être ISO-8859-1. Il n'y a pas tentative NuSOAP pour soutenir UTF-8 dans les WSDL

Ce lien serait utile pour vous http://comments.gmane.org/gmane.comp.php.nusoap.general/3630

0

Peut être utf8_encode pourrait vous aider (avant d'assurer la sécurité des données).